Phone Information Center Compliance Analyst / ASSOCIATE GOVERNMENTAL PROGRAM ANALYST
AGPA: Under the direction of the Staff Services Manager I (SSM I) in the Program Support Division (PSD) of the Consumer Assistance Program (CAP), the Associate Governmental Program Analyst (AGPA) serves as the CAP subject matter expert (SME) and is independently responsible for the development of data-driven strategies to drive continuous improvement, enhance operational efficiency and optimize the consumer experience.
SSA: Under the supervision of the Staff Services Manager I (SSM I) in the Program Support Division of the Consumer Assistance Program (CAP), the Staff Services Analyst (SSA) serves as a CAP consultant and is responsible for developing data-driven strategies to drive continuous improvement, enhance operational efficiency and optimize the consumer experience.

Working Conditions
The incumbent works 40 hours per week, Monday through Friday 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. in an office setting with artificial light and temperature control. The incumbent must be able to frequently remain in a stationary position at a workstation throughout the day and must occasionally position self to perform a variety of tasks including retrieval of files. The incumbent must be able to use a laptop and possess knowledge and experience of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, Adobe Acrobat and be able to navigate within other internal database. Incumbent must possess good communication skills, use good judgment in decision-making, exercise creativity and flexibility in problem identification and resolution, manage time and resources effectively and be responsive to CAP management needs.
